
Current Fish & Oyster, nestled in a beautifully restored historic building in downtown Salt Lake City, offers an exceptional dining experience centered around fresh, sustainably sourced seafood. The restaurant’s commitment to quality shines through its daily rotating oyster selection and innovative fish dishes. Complementing the cuisine is an expertly curated wine list and creative craft cocktails, all served by a knowledgeable, attentive staff.
Industrial-chic bar & eatery offering regional, sustainable seafood plates in a historic building.

Came for our anniversary and was greeted with a happy anniversary menu and friendly waiter. Let’s get to food:
Apps: crab cake 9/10, calamari 10/10, broiled oysters 9/10 all very delicious, tender, fresh and seasoned impeccably. I would come back just to eat all the apps!
Entrees: Scallops 9/10 loved this dish, scallops were tender they gave a big portion.. sauce was very ginger forward which I could do a little less of and the carrots were so good! ..
Sea bass 9/10 the fish was cooked and seasoned so well! I loved the citrus sauce and my only complaint was the beans would do better pureed bc there was a lot of texture with the cabbage already.
Whipped potatoes 11/10 SO GOOD buttery goodness highly recommend!
Drinks & dessert: really enjoyed the Pinot we ordered and the orange wine was decent. For dessert we got affogato and it was perfect not too rich or sweet to end the meal feeling refreshed! We would’ve liked if they would have given us a little happy anniversary doodle on the dessert plate or something to make it feel more special.
Service: our waiter Ehsan (sorry if I got it wrong) was kind, attentive and even helped giving us some of his fave spots in slc.
Ambiance: not too formal nor casual with lots of windows.
